WebJul 8, 2024 · Polyphenol oxidase, an enzyme found in avocados, causes the fruit’s flesh to turn brown when exposed to oxygen. This is similar to your utensils getting rust—only that it affects plants. When the avocado is chopped, the enzyme is exposed to oxygen in the air, causing the flesh’s surface to turn brown.
